Back to Sleep week is focused on safe and healthy sleep for baby. Today’s post featured the Snuza Pico wearable monitor, which is a must-have for tech-oriented parents, parents of newborns, parents of multiples, parents of toddlers, and great for traveling.

We have highlighted another amazing Snuza product – the Hero –  in our past Back to Sleep event. The Snuza Pico wearable monitor is an advanced multi-sensor smart device for infants and children. For the first year of life, the Snuza Pico wearable monitor provides peace-of-mind movement monitoring in addition to sleep analytics, skin temperature and body position monitoring. After one year of age, the movement monitoring function may be turned off, allowing caregivers to primarily monitor their child’s sleep patterns, which has been proven to be a critical aspect of healthy brain development.

The monitor attaches to baby’s diaper and connects via Bluetooth to a smartphone app. The Pico uses a patented contactless sensor, meaning it does not need to be in direct contact with the baby’s skin, which reduces false alarms caused by loss of contact. If there is no abdominal movement detected after 15 seconds, the device will gently vibrate in an effort to rouse the child awake. After 20 seconds of no abdominal movement, the Pico will alarm.

When thinking about baby safety on the go, remember these guidelines for a safe outing:

  • All strollers come fitted with standard safety harness straps.
  • Use straps at all times, even if it’s a short trip.
  • Harness straps stop the child from climbing out of the seat and falling, and protects the child should the stroller tip over.
  • Safety straps should be used regardless of the child’s age.
  • Many strollers feature a five-point harness system, which features straps that secure over each shoulder, at both sides of the waist, and in the middle of the legs.
  • It is important to always use all straps, not just lap straps or shoulder straps alone.
  • If you use a soft carrier, select one made of a durable, washable fabric with sturdy, adjustable straps.
  • Read and follow all manufacturer’s instructions for use, age and weight recommendations.
  • Be sure baby’s weight is evenly distributed in the carrier and all safety straps are secured.
  • Check for ripped seams, sharp edges, and missing or loose snaps.
  • Always keep one hand on baby when tightening/loosening straps for any reason or taking baby out or putting baby in.

Did you know September is Baby Safety Month? September is Baby Safety Month, sponsored annually by the Juvenile Products Manufacturers Association (JPMA). This year, JPMA is helping educate parents and caregivers on the importance of properly using straps on all juvenile products. 

Strap In For Safety

Keeping your baby safe and well is your number one goal as a parent so it goes without saying that you take every precaution when creating a safe environment.  But unfortunately, falls are still the leading cause of non-fatal injuries for all young children in the U.S. In fact, approximately 8,000 children are treated in emergency rooms for fall-related injuries every day. With these staggering statistics, be confident that you are doing everything right when it comes to your baby’s safety.

What Can You Do?

Direct supervision is a sure-fire way to prevent injury – watch, listen and stay near your child.  Strap In For Safety!

Child safety devices, like safety belts and straps, should always be used when available.

Straps and safety belts on baby gear reduce the risk of infant fall injuries.

For the safest product use, be sure to read and follow all manufacturer’s instructions and warning labels.

Whether it’s in the home or on the go, learn how to properly use straps on a variety of products and the importance of correctly using them EVERY time in order to keep baby safe.

Wouldn’t it be wonderful to have a way to monitor your new little one while they’re sleeping, so you can rest easy and sleep too? Snuza,  known for spearheading the innovation in one of the biggest trends in the marketplace right now, wearable tech for infants, has just released their Snuza Pico Movement Monitor, which is unlike anything else on the market. While some of the newer baby movement monitors are fitted beneath the baby’s mattress, Snuza monitors attach directly to a baby’s diaper and alarms if no abdominal movement is detected. This early detection provided by Snuza monitors offers a solution to help bring peace of mind to parents.

However, Snuza has recently revolutionized the monitor market with their Snuza Pico. The revolutionary new Snuza Pico is the first wearable baby movement monitor in the line that allows parents to directly connect to a smartphone or tablet via a Bluetooth App! The Pico attaches to your baby’s diaper and using a patented contactless sensor, monitors abdominal movement of your baby. By using this contactless sensor, the Pico does not need to touch your baby’s skin, which in turn reduces the amount of false alarms caused by loss of contact. If there is no abdominal movement detected after 15 seconds, the device will vibrate in an effort to rouse the child awake. After 20 seconds of no abdominal movement, the Pico will alarm. Parents can also select an optional movement rate warning, which alerts parents if baby’s abdomen moves less than eight times per minute.

The App, which is Apple and Android compatible, also monitors a baby’s abdominal movement, skin temperature, sleeping position (side, face-down, face up) and fall detector. It also features an on/off button and alerts parents if they become out of range. The Pico unit can be accessed by multiple smartphones so that parents and/or caregivers can monitor multiple Pico units from one or more smartphones. Snuza wearable movement monitors are made with hypo-allergenic, medical grade plastics and do not send or receive radio frequency signals. There are NO wires, cords, cables or sensor pads that could potentially harm baby. Weighing only 1oz, these monitors are the lightest of their kind on the market today.

Sustainable Nursery – Save Vs. Splurge

by Gugu Guru Leave a Comment

Having a baby in the age of environmental guilt is a daunting task. You want to buy all the right things to create the safest, healthiest, and most planet-friendly environment for your newborn. But can you afford it? From the author of Spit That Out! The Overly Informed Parent’s Guide to Raising Healthy Kids in the Age of Environmental Guilt, here is Paige Wolf’s advice on when to splurge and how to save.

13122900_10153766824657933_6215629560069415146_o

Photo from Live Sweet Photography

SPLURGE: Mattress

With the growing knowledge of phthalates, VOCs, and toxic flame retardants in conventional mattresses, new parents are increasingly interested in organic mattresses for their babies and children. After all, babies and young children spend at least half their time in bed! Unfortunately, without proper knowledge, you might find yourself buying a fake organic mattress. Since greenwashing knows no limits –and no government agency regulates the labeling of mattresses as “organic” or “natural” several companies label their mattresses ‘organic’ when they are technically not. Look for certifications by the Global Organic Textile Standard (GOTS) and GREENGUARD®.

Gugu Recommended: Naturepedic Mattresses

SAVE: Bedding

Organic cotton sheets and pillowcases are more accessible and affordable than ever. Big box stores like Target sell 100% organic cotton bedding for as low as $9.99 for a crib sheet.

Gugu Recommended: Burt’s Bees Organic Crib Sheets

micuna-n-n-nb-pa-2

SPLURGE: Crib

Due to changing safety standards, cribs are often not a safe secondhand bet. New crib safety standards took effect in June 2011 and made most cribs sold before that date technically unsafe. And cheap cribs made from pressed wood products such as particle board, plywood and fiberboard (or MDF) typically contain VOCs as well as formaldehyde in the glues and adhesives used to bond the particles together. Though hard wood is more expensive, it’s usually durable, making it a solid investment (bearing of course crib standards don’t change again!)

Gugu Recommended: Micuna Cribs

SAVE: Bed, Dresser, and Other Furnishings

When it comes to other nursery furnishings, secondhand can be a fantastic way to save money and reduce consumption. Parents are constantly selling – and even giving away – gently used furnishings on CraigsList, local parent message boards, and even Buy Nothing Project Facebook Groups. We got our son’s convertible IKEA twin bed for $20 on Craigslist and a beautifully made wooden bed for our daughter for a steal from a neighborhood group. Just keep an eye out for anything too vintage, which could be a lead paint hazard. If you are unsure, pick up a lead testing kit for about $7.

SPLURGE: Paint

This really isn’t too much of a splurge, because no-VOC (volatile organic compound) paint is now available from most major brands with a minimal premium – especially if you are just doing one room. VOC vapors can continue to leak into the air long after the paint is dry, so it’s not something you want a baby or pregnant woman exposed to.

Gugu Recommended: Lullaby Paints

finn

SAVE: Clothing/Layette

I don’t care how precious that designer onesie is. It will get one-to-two wears at best before it is completely destroyed. In fact, you will be lucky if it lasts an hour. Take advantage of your community and accept all the hand-me-downs you can get. While it may not always be organic, hand-me-down clothing that has been washed several times has less residue from dyes and flame retardants. If you don’t have easy access to hand-me-downs from a close family member, explore online community groups where parents offer up gently used clothing for cheap and even for free!
